A newly released investigation has declared the boeing starliner crewed test flight a "Type A" mishap — the agency's highest severity grade — after failures left two astronauts stranded in orbit for months. The agency's administrator has called out poor decision-making and leadership failures at the contractor and within the agency, and officials say corrective actions and accountability measures will follow.

Boeing Starliner investigation: Type A classification and immediate findings

The published report classifies the mission as a Type A mishap, a designation reserved for the most serious incidents that can include significant financial damage, loss of control of a vehicle, or the potential for loss of life. While the investigation notes there were no injuries and control of the spacecraft was regained before docking, the classification reflects that the mission posed a life-threatening risk.

  • Mission timeline: The crewed test launched on a crewed mission date in 2024 and was intended to last eight to 14 days; it was extended after propulsion anomalies and the spacecraft ultimately returned to Earth without the two astronauts in September 2024.
  • Crew impact: The two astronauts remained on the International Space Station for months and later returned aboard another provider's crewed flight in March 2025; both have since retired from the agency.
  • Contributing factors: Investigators identified a combination of hardware failures, qualification gaps, leadership missteps, and cultural breakdowns that created conditions inconsistent with the agency's human spaceflight safety standards.
  • Operational risks: Thruster failures left the vehicle dangerously out of control at points during the approach to the space station; manual intervention and recovery of propulsion systems enabled a safe docking.

Organizational accountability, corrective actions and what comes next

The agency's administrator described the mission as one of the most serious mishaps in the agency's history and has emphasized leadership accountability. The investigation highlights both poor engineering and a lack of oversight at the contractor, as well as programmatic decisions at the agency that influenced engineering and operational choices.

As a result of the report, the agency will accept the investigation's findings as final and is moving to implement corrective actions intended to address technical root causes and organizational shortcomings. Work to understand and fix the technical problems is ongoing, and the agency has stated that the vehicle will return to flight only when those corrective measures and recommendations have been fully addressed.

Operational lessons and risks still under review

The investigation underscores how compounding technical issues and cultural problems can turn a short test flight into a prolonged, high-risk event. Engineers and program managers are continuing technical root cause work, and the report calls for changes aimed at improving qualification procedures, oversight, and the relationship between contractor and agency teams.

Recent materials note that the spacecraft had faced challenges in prior missions and that those issues were nevertheless accepted for crewed flight. The agency has emphasized transparency about both successes and shortcomings and the necessity of owning mistakes to prevent recurrence.

Uncertainties remain as technical analyses continue and corrective steps are implemented. The investigation and the agency's response mark a significant moment for the commercial crew program; the focus now shifts to remedying the identified failures and ensuring future flights meet human spaceflight safety standards.
